Although his identity remains a secret—he jokingly compares himself to Bruce Wayne and Batman—Mr. White's message is simple: "Let's Dance!" Uninterested in recognition, Mr. White undergoes two hours of makeup before every performance to ensure that his music does the talking. In that sense, he is the perfect representative of Sensation.

Not only is he the official mascot of the event, but the pale-faced performer is also its resident DJ. His sets take house music back to its roots, offering the audience a pumping, pulsing, pop-free experience that can best be described as a pure party feeling.
